Tender description

The Transport Systems Catapult (TSC) is seeking to undertake a research project on behalf of the Centre for Connected and Autonomous Vehicles (CCAV) to quantify the size, economic impact and contribution of Connected and Autonomous Vehicles (CAVs) to the UK economy between now and 2035. The outputs from this project will be used by CCAV to develop a business case for future Government intervention in the CAV market. To align with CCAV needs, the project needs to be completed by 31st March 2017.
